Transaction 323fcd042540a40e1a406fc420e28eb93f01636e10630ddb0cff8c585388bf1e
1 Input
1 Output
-
323fcd042540a40e1a406fc420e28eb93f01636e10630ddb0cff8c585388bf1e:0
- value
- 641468537
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ea112d3ab2e63d135cd271e9fa1a9a35c69b7ee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5xHgry7YYpx8NoLGhDhN8tTc1Chn32kD